The women-led Queens Gaming Collective has announced that 2019 FIFA World Cup Women's Winner Allie Long has joined her advisory board as strategic advisor.
As part of his role, Long will partner with the Queens Gaming Collective's roster of creators, streamers and competitors to help grow their gaming brands and businesses.
Current player OL Reign will also help the company achieve its goal of becoming "the industry-defining women's gaming and esports lifestyle brand," according to a press release.
